
BASILAN PROVINCE – Three members of a farming family was found dead Monday inside a kiln in Isabela City in Basilan province in the restive Muslim autonomous region in Mindanao, police said.
Police identified the dead as Rotillo Gonzaga, 57; his wife Lucia, 47, and their 11-year old son Virgilio whose bodies were discovered at Campo Barn in the village of Kapayawan.
An investigation was launched by the police to determine who was behind the grisly murders.
No individual or group claimed responsibility for the killings as police questioned several people in the area to aid them in the investigation.
Relatives of the victims condemned the killings and demanded justice for the murders. The news of the brutal killings quickly spread in the village and sent shivers to many people in the area. (Ely Dumaboc – Mindanao Examiner)
